WebJun 17, 2024 · SQL Server Browser service uses UDP static port 1434. It reads the registry for the assigned TCP port. SQL Server client library connects and sends a UDP message … WebMay 3, 2024 · TCP port 1434 (For DAC Connection) For Named Instances TCP Port (Whichever port the SQL Server is listening on – Check the Error Log for Port Details) UDP …
WebFeb 28, 2024 · If UDP port 1434 is blocked, Setup cannot communicate with remote Microsoft SQL Server instances, which causes the installation process to fail. WebMar 16, 2012 · Port 1434 is only used by the SQL Browser to map instance names to ports. If you specify a port number, the SQL Browser and port 1434 does not come into play.
